Our Philosophy and Code of Conduct

Dynamites encourage parent and supporter involvement to support the club in creating an environment of participation, respect, and teamwork.

We aim to see this philosophy and code of conduct reflected in the behaviour of all our players, parents, coaches, and umpires - both at training and on game days and off the court.

If you register to North Perth Dynamites Netball Club, you and your parents/guardians agree to demonstrate and live by the Club Philosophy and Code of Conduct. If for any reason these values/behaviours are not being demonstrated, the Club will take action on any player or parent/guardian including warning, benching and termination of membership.

PNA publishes a Competition Handbook which includes a code of behaviour as well as various policies and rules to ensure appropriate conduct on and off the Court. North Perth Dynamites requires all players and its members to adhere to those codes, rules and policies. Failure to do so may result in the termination of membership.
